EVANSVILLE, Ind. – A pair of close games went against the Lewis baseball team Friday (April 6) as it fell to Southern Indiana 12-11 and 6-5 in Great Lakes Valley Conference games at USI Baseball Field. Lewis is now 10-16-1 overall, 4-5 in GLVC, while USI is 14-13 overall, 6-4 in GLVC. The two teams will play two more games Saturday (April 7) at 1 p.m.

Game one – USI 12, Lewis 11
Southern Indiana picked up a run in the bottom of the first before Lewis scored seven unanswered. The Flyers scored twice in the fourth inning as
Neal Tyrell (Minooka, Ill./Minooka) doubled to score
Trayvon Johnson (Berkeley, Ill./St. Joseph's), who previously doubled. After an
Anthony Rios (Lemont, Ill./St. Laurence) single,
Sam Cybulski (Clarendon Hills, Ill./Lyons Township) hit a sacrifice fly to left center to score Tyrell. Both Johnson and Tyrell scored again in the fifth inning on RBI from
Austin Tittle (Lemont, Ill./Lemont) and Rios to make it 4-1.

A leadoff double in the sixth from
Jermaine Terry (Plainfield, Ill./Plainfield South) led to three more runs. Terry scored on a RBI from
Connor Rutherford (DePere, Wis./DePere),
Brandon Post (Elk Grove Village, Ill./Elk Grove) scored when Johnson reached on a fielding error and Rutherford scored on a Tyrell single. The Screaming Eagles mounted their comeback starting in the bottom of the sixth, scoring two runs and then added six more in the seventh to take a 9-7 lead. The Flyers came back with four runs in the top of the eighth as Johnson singled to score
Anthony Cavalieri (Western Springs, Ill./Fenwick) and Rios doubled to score Johnson and Rutherford. A bunt single by Cybulski scored Tyrell to give Lewis an 11-9 lead. USI scored three times in the eighth and overcame a leadoff walk in the ninth to win the game.

Cavalieri went 4-for-5 for the Flyers, while Tyrell and Johnson each had three hits, scored three runs and had two RBI. Rios also had three hits to go along with three RBI, while Johnson tallied a pair of doubles. Nick Gobert (3-2) earned the win for USI, while
Matt McCauley (Oakville, Mo./St. John Vianney) (1-1) took the loss for Lewis.

Game two – USI 6, Lewis 5
The Screaming Eagles again jumped out to a 1-0 lead in the first inning and again Lewis came back to take the lead, this time with two runs in the third inning. On the ninth pitch of the at bat with the bases loaded, Tyrell singled, scoring two runs. However, USI responded with four runs in the bottom of the third to take a 5-2 lead. The Flyers scored two more in the fourth as Cavalieri hit a sacrifice fly to center, scoring Tittle. Johnson then walked with the bases loaded to score the second run. A Johnson strikeout in the sixth led to a tie game as he reached first on a wild pitch and Terry scored. USI won the game with a walk-off single in the bottom of the seventh.

Rutherford went 2-for-3 in the contest and reached base three times in the game, while Tyrell had a pair of RBI. Tyler Hagedorn (2-2) got the win for USI, while
Blake Marks (Gardner, Ill./Gardner-South Wilmington) (4-2) picked up the loss, going 6.1 innings, allowing seven hits and six runs, with none of the runs being earned.
